- .svn 隐藏文件夹保存着SVN当前同步文件夹的一些元信息,不要修改,也不要删除 。 不过有时候被锁定的时候,可以删除这个文件夹中的lock文件以解锁,但是这样做有可能会造成同步错误。
- 添加文件的时候,需要在要添加的文件上点右键然后Add...,然后要想与服务器同步,还需要Commit提交。
- 提交失败的时候,可以试着先更新一下,或者清理一下,然后再提交。
- 平时开发过各中,可以一个人(小组)创建一个开发分支,这样每个人的文件同步不会跟其它人产生冲突。必要的时候可以进行分支合并。
- 如果删除了.svn文件夹,造成一个子文件夹不能同步 ,可以再把这个文件夹checkout一下,这样便可以重新恢复同步信息,自动建立.svn文件夹.
- Update是与服务器最新版本保持同步,如果本地版本比服务器版本旧,则更新本地文件为服务器版本,如果本地版本比服务器版本更新,则不进行操作。
- Commit是提交本地的修改文件,本地文件修改后,或者通过Add添加了新文件,或者通过Delete删除了文件,或者移动、复制了文件,都需要通过Commit提交来提交到服务器上。
- Revert如果要恢复到服务器上的最新版本(某个版本),使用Revert
- Update to version 是与服务器上的某个文件比较,如果服务器上的文件更新,则同步,否则不做操作。
SVN使用补遗-使用中应注意的问题
最新推荐文章于 2018-06-26 16:09:01 发布
本文详细介绍了SVN的使用注意事项,包括隐藏的.svn文件夹的处理、文件添加与提交、解决冲突和分支管理。强调了保持目录同步的重要性,以及如何处理锁定、更新、提交、合并等问题,提供了版本控制的有效策略。
摘要由CSDN通过智能技术生成